Лучшей эффективности можно добиться, определяя объекты только с одним идентификатором типа в каждой приоритетной очереди.
Максимальное число объектов, посылаемых в одном ASDU, может меняться в зависимости от типа и определяется максимально допустимой длиной блока данных прикладного уровня (не более 253 байта для кадра переменной длины). ASDU автоматически заполняются объектами до определенной максимальной длины, если в очереди имеется достаточное число готовых, последовательно запомненных объектов с одинаковым идентификатором типа.
Недопустимо задерживать передачу ASDU, пытаясь дождаться вновь поступающих в буфер объектов, которые могли бы использоваться для заполнения этого ASDU до максимально возможной длины.
Если контролируемая станция имеет два или более блоков данных ASDU, готовых к передаче одновременно, она должна посылать их в соответствии с приоритетами очередей, независимо от того, какие данные появились первыми. Приоритеты очередей, применяемых в курсовом проекте, даны в табл.
Приоритеты очередей данных на контролируемой станции
Таблица
TI-тип информации |
Описание |
Комментарии |
45, 46 |
Передача команд |
Отраженные ASDU |
1…44 |
Сообщение о событии |
Причина передачи – спорадическая (COT=3) |
102 |
Команда чтения |
|
100 |
Опрос станции |
Команда опроса станции требует от контролируемых станций передать актуальное состояние их информации, обычно передаваемой спорадически (причина передачи = 3), на контролирующую станцию с причинами передачи от <20> до <36>. Опрос станции используется для синхронизации информации о процессе на контролирующей станции и контролируемых станциях. Он также используется для обновления информации на контролирующей станции после процедуры инициализации или после того, как контролирующая станция обнаружит потерю канала (безуспешное повторение запроса канального уровня) и последующее восстановление его.
Ответ на опрос станции должен включать объекты информации о процессе, которые запомнены на контролируемой станции. В ответ на опрос станции эти объекты информации передаются с идентификаторами типов <1>, <3>, <7>, <11>, а также могут также передаваться с идентификатором типа <30>. Указывается причина передачи <1> - периодически/циклически, <2> - фоновое сканирование или <3> - спорадическая передача
Объем хранимых данных определяется принятым форматом обмена с прикладным уровнем. Ниже приведена одна из возможных структур информации для одного объекта. Кодировка групп информации принята согласно рис. 68. Предполагается для каждого типа блока (TI) применение отдельной очереди.
Так положение коммутационного аппарата характеризуется состоянием двух бит DPI, значение которых может быть получено опросом реле контроля состояния выключателя KQT и KQC. Метка времени может быть получена от системы единого времени, либо от терминала контролируемого аппарата. Бит статуса данных SD и бит статуса описателя качества SP необходимы для формирования данных при запросе от пункта управления состояния изменившихся данных или изменившихся описателях качества данных. Бит статуса вычисляется при записи данных в очередь.
Положение коммутационного аппарата (код группы 1)
KQC – состояние реле контроля положения включено
KQT – состояние реле контроля положения отключено
SD – статус данных: 1 - данные изменились, 0 - данные неизменны
SP – статус описателя качества: 1 - изменился, 0 – неизменен
Уважаемый посетитель!
Чтобы распечатать файл, скачайте его (в формате Word).
Ссылка на скачивание - внизу страницы.